[Sherwin Carlquist field notebook from 1951- 1961 expedition to California]

Description: A field notebook containing handwritten notes by botanist Sherwin Carlquist during a field expedition to California between 1951 - 1961. The brown cloth-covered notebook has sewn binding along the left edge. There is a typed label on the front cover with the title "Field Book I" and name "Sherwin J. Carlquist". The edges of the cover are worn and there are dirt stains throughout. The contents of the notebook record Carlquist's field observations and voucher specimen collecting events. They incl… more
